Ward Al-Barri
Jordanian footballer From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Ward Helal Khalid Al-Barri (Arabic: ورد هلال خالد البرّي; born 29 July 1997) is a Jordanian professional footballer who plays as a right-back for Jordanian Pro League club Al-Hussein.

Club career
Shabab Al-Ordon
Born in Zarqa, Al-Barri began his career at Shabab Al-Ordon.
Al-Faisaly
On 4 February 2021, Al-Faisaly announced the signing of Al-Barri alongside Mohammad Tannous.[1]
On 10 July 2023, Al-Barri's contract was terminated.[2]
Sahab
Al-Barri played with Sahab during the 2023–24 Jordanian Pro League season.[3]
Return to Shabab Al-Ordon
With Sahab relegated to the Jordanian First Division League, Al-Barri decided to return to Shabab Al-Ordon due to the club giving him an opportunity as a professional earlier on in his career, as well as strengthening the team alongside its younger set of players.[3]
Al-Hussein
On 23 June 2025, Al-Hussein announced the signing of Al-Barri, after a successful season with Shabab Al-Ordon.[4]

International career
On 2 January 2025, Al-Barri was called up to the Jordan national football team for a camp held in Amman.[5][6] Al-Barri was called up once again to the national team to participate in a training camp held in Doha.[7]
